The majority of this card is recycled cardboard for the TLC challenge to use a cardboard box. I keep the cardboard from the calenders that I get, so I used that rather than a box. Also used a nice heavy piece of cb that didn't have the corrugated layer, this is what the butterfly and plaid pieces are made from.
The sunflower is made from the pealed off piece of cb that then revealed the nice corrugated layer, which is the base of this card. There's lots of texture going on here. The butterfly actually has the flower button shape as part of the stamp, and I just happened to have the shell flower to fit.
